For daily consumption everyone needs to take a balanced diet for normal and healthy growth mostly advisable for a growing child and this has become very difficult to meet with the demand especially with green vegetables due to the fact that in Kenya there are only two rainy seasons and when there are no rains the plants cannot survive the sunny conditions. Due to this reason there arose a need to show the guardians a way of growing vegetables by the use of a technique called portable gardens which is a technique that involves the use of waste water at home which would otherwise be wasted. The water is first treated by adding wood ash and there after irrigated to the plants which are planted on portable gardens like old sacks, old tires, and even on old tins. This ensures that the guardians have vegetables on their homes throughout the year and therefore promoting a healthy growth.
